What is Minoxidil Lotion?

Minoxidil is FDA-approved medicine for the treatment of hair loss, particularly androgenetic alopecia, also known as male and female pattern baldness. It’s available in various forms like foam and liquid solutions in the market. Men often use a higher concentration of minoxidil, typically 5%, to address male pattern baldness, which tends to be more severe. Women usually use a lower concentration, typically 2%, as they tend to experience more diffuse hair thinning and may be more sensitive to the medication.

The choice of concentration should be determined by a dermatologist based on the individual’s specific hair loss condition and needs.

How Does Minoxidil Work?

  • Prolongs Growth Phase: It extends the anagen (growth) phase of the hair cycle, leading to longer, thicker hair strands.
  • Awakens Dormant Follicles: Minoxidil may stimulate dormant hair follicles, encouraging them to produce new hair.
  • Blood Flow Enhancement: Increased nutrient and oxygen delivery to follicles may promote hair growth.

Myths & Reality

  • Instant Results

Myth: Minoxidil provides instant hair regrowth.

Reality: It takes time, often several months, to see noticeable results. Patience is key.

  • Permanent Solution

Myth: Minoxidil offers a permanent cure for hair loss.

Reality: It manages hair loss but doesn’t cure it. Continued use is often required to maintain results.

  • Excessive Application

Myth: Applying more minoxidil than recommended leads to faster results.

Reality: Overuse won’t speed up hair growth and may increase side effects.

  • Hair Everywhere

Myth: Minoxidil can grow hair anywhere on the body.

Reality: It’s designed for the scalp and may not work the same way on other body areas.

  • No Maintenance

Myth: Once hair grows, you can stop using minoxidil without consequences.

Reality: Discontinuing use may lead to gradual hair loss.

Using Minoxidil Lotion:

  • Clean Scalp: Ensure your scalp is clean and completely dry before applying.
  • Patch test: Always do a patch test on the first application to check for any redness or rash.
  • Apply as Directed: Follow the product label or dermatologist’s instructions for the specific concentration and frequency.
  • Use Fingertips: Apply with fingertips, not nails, to the affected areas of the scalp.
  • Gentle Massage: Gently massage the lotion into the scalp to distribute it evenly.
  • Allow to Dry: Let it dry completely for 2-4 hours before styling or applying other products.
  • Consistent Use: Apply regularly as directed, as results may take several months to become noticeable.
  • Avoid Overuse: Applying more than recommended won’t speed up hair growth and may increase the risk of side effects.

Potential Side Effects:

While minoxidil is generally safe and well-tolerated, it may cause side effects in some individuals. Common side effects include scalp irritation, itching, and dryness. Excessive self usage of it can lead to unwanted facial hair growth. These symptoms are usually mild and temporary. However, if you experience any severe side effects consult your dermatologist immediately.
